本篇目录:

如何修改framework下面的odex文件

在Ubuntu的登陆界面中选择gnome桌面登陆,有两个任选其一。由于登陆界面不好截图,虚拟机中也没装最新版的ubuntu104,所以还是描述一下大家应该找得到。

状态栏信息通知文字颜色,是由framework-res.apk文件里resvalues下的colors.xml文件控制的,所以我们只需修改colors.xml文件就可以了。另外,此文件还控制下拉栏的文字颜色,可以修改。

android修改framework(android修改状态栏背景色)  第1张

下载Java SE Development Kit (JDK),在百度上搜索jdk即可搜索到,然后下载安装。安装Java SE Development Kit (JDK)完成后点击 开始 在搜索程序和文件中输入cmd。点击程序cmd.exe 打开cmd管理员窗口。

dex文件。打开文件管理器,将services.jar移动到/system/framework目录下。修改权限为三读一写(644)。切记一定要删除/system/framework/oat/arm64目录下的services.odex文件,一定要删除!重启生效。

要先把core.apk和core.odex合并之后再进行反编译,不然就会提示这个。

如何导入com.android.internal.telephony

1、将android系统框架下的\framework\telephony\java\com\android\internal\telephony目录中的ITelephony.aidl文件复制到上面创建的包(com.android.internal.telephony )中。

android修改framework(android修改状态栏背景色)  第2张

2、用反射调用 “com.android.internal.telephony.PhoneFactory”,“com.android.internal.telephony.CallManager”,“com.android.internal.telephony.Phone”中的方法。

3、您可以找到Android源码,利用Java反射实现,比如:Method method = Class.forName(com.android.internal.telephony.connection).getMethod(isalive, String.class);然后就实例化了这个方法,就可以调用了。

4、添加一个类,当然你不能添加到别的类里面了。。

5、aidl文件的包名必须和aidl目录下java的包名一致。

android修改framework(android修改状态栏背景色)  第3张

...如何通过framework的修改使其默认主题改成Theme.Light或者其它主题...

首先在manifests.xml里面修改application节点下android:theme=@style/Theme.AppCompat.Light.NoActionBar,这样就能让你新建出来的layout都是白色没有表头的。改完之后你之前的layout如果还是黑色的,就按照图片上这样改。

就有多少个.theme文件,它就是Windows主题文件,一个桌面主题的总定义文件,它的内 容不多,是文本格式的,以XP的默认官方主题Luna为例,大家用任何一个文本编辑器打开 Luna.theme,可以很直观的看到其内容。

使用 UxTheme.dll 破解版之后,无需任何其他的软件你就可以在XP的显示属性中管理和调用第三方的主题和风格。

UxTheme.dll 就是XP系统主题支持的核心文件,也就是它让XP无法使用第三方主题。如果你不想安装 StyleXP,那么你可以通过破* UxTheme.dll 文件来达到目的。

到此,以上就是小编对于android修改状态栏背景色的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。